Understanding Depression

Depression is not simply feeling sad or down. It is a serious mental health disorder that can significantly impact a person's daily life, relationships, and overall well-being. Dr. Eric Murphy emphasizes the importance of recognizing the signs and symptoms of depression:

"Depression encompasses a range of symptoms, including persistent feelings of sadness, loss of interest in activities, changes in appetite and sleep patterns, difficulty concentrating, feelings of worthlessness or guilt, and even thoughts of self-harm or suicide. It is crucial to seek professional help if you or someone you know is experiencing these symptoms."

Depression can affect anyone, regardless of age, gender, or background. It is essential to address it with compassion and understanding, both as individuals and as a society.

The Role of Therapy in Depression Treatment

Therapy plays a vital role in the treatment of depression. It provides individuals with a safe and supportive space to explore their emotions, thoughts, and behaviors. Dr. Eric Murphy explains the benefits of therapy:

"Therapy offers a collaborative and non-judgmental environment where individuals can work through their feelings and gain insight into the root causes of their depression. It helps individuals develop coping strategies, improve self-esteem, and enhance overall well-being. Therapy for depression is not a one-size-fits-all approach; it is tailored to meet the unique needs of each individual."

Therapy can take various forms, including individual therapy, group therapy, and couples or family therapy. The choice of therapy depends on the individual's preferences and circumstances.

Different Approaches to Depression Therapy

Dr. Eric Murphy discusses some of the most commonly used therapeutic approaches in treating depression:

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) is a widely recognized and evidence-based approach for treating depression. It focuses on identifying and challenging negative thought patterns and replacing them with more positive and realistic ones. Dr. Eric Murphy explains:

"CBT helps individuals become aware of their negative thoughts and beliefs that contribute to their depression. By challenging these thoughts and replacing them with more balanced and rational ones, individuals can change their emotional and behavioral responses. CBT equips individuals with practical strategies to manage their symptoms and improve their overall well-being."

Interpersonal Therapy (IPT)

Interpersonal Therapy (IPT) focuses on improving an individual's relationships and social functioning, as these factors often play a significant role in depression. Dr. Eric Murphy highlights the importance of addressing interpersonal issues:

"Depression can strain relationships and lead to isolation. IPT aims to identify and address problematic interpersonal patterns, enhance communication skills, and develop healthier ways of relating to others. By improving social support and resolving conflicts, individuals can experience relief from depressive symptoms."

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T)

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) is a mindfulness-based approach that encourages individuals to accept their thoughts and emotions rather than trying to suppress or control them. Dr. Eric Murphy explains the underlying principles of ACT:

"ACT helps individuals develop psychological flexibility by teaching them to observe their thoughts and emotions without judgment. It encourages individuals to identify their core values and take committed action towards leading a more meaningful life, even in the presence of difficult emotions. ACT can be particularly helpful for individuals struggling with self-acceptance and finding purpose."

The Importance of Seeking Professional Help

Dr. Eric Murphy emphasizes the importance of seeking professional help when dealing with depression:

"While self-help strategies can be beneficial, therapy provides individuals with the guidance and expertise of trained professionals. Psychologists are equipped with the knowledge and skills to assess, diagnose, and treat depression effectively. They create personalized treatment plans tailored to each individual's unique needs, ensuring the best possible outcomes."

It is crucial to remember that seeking help is not a sign of weakness but a courageous step towards healing and well-being.

Mental Wellness Programs and Beyond

Alongside therapy, mental wellness programs can play a significant role in supporting individuals with depression. These programs often encompass a holistic approach, involving various therapeutic modalities, such as mindfulness practices, exercise, and nutrition. Dr. Eric Murphy highlights the importance of a comprehensive approach:

"Mental wellness programs aim to address the multiple dimensions of an individual's well-being. By combining therapy with other supportive interventions, individuals can strengthen their resilience, develop healthy coping mechanisms, and improve their overall quality of life. It is important to adopt a multi-faceted approach to depression treatment to optimize outcomes."

Furthermore, Dr. Eric Murphy emphasizes the importance of raising awareness about mental health and reducing the stigma surrounding it:

"By openly discussing mental health and sharing our experiences, we can create a more supportive and understanding society. It is crucial to foster an environment where individuals feel safe and encouraged to seek help without fear of judgment or discrimination."
